Mesothelioma is a rare form of cancer, can be fatal and occurs on the tissue of your chest cavity and lungs as well as your abdomen. Asbestos exposure is only the one known cause of mesothelioma. The cancer is typically diagnosed decades after the initial exposure. Asbestos sufferers may seek financial compensation through a lawsuit or a trust fund claim.

Asbestos trust funds are set by companies who have filed for bankruptcy protection in the wake of asbestos litigation. The funds compensate victims without having to go through a lengthy trial.

Fees

A diagnosis of mesothelioma can be stressful for a patient and their family. It can also create financial issues due to the high cost of treatment as well as the loss of income. A lawsuit could seek compensation to help the victims recover and pay for living and treatment costs. Families can also file a wrongful-death suit when a loved one dies from mesothelioma.

A mesothelioma lawyer can talk about the legal options for a client's situation, and help them understand the potential benefits from their case. Mesothelioma lawyers usually charge a contingency cost, which means they are only paid when they achieve the settlement or verdict for their client's case. The fees paid by law firms and the complexity of a case vary.

The majority of mesothelioma lawyers provide a free evaluation. They will also explain to you the fees they charge clients and the differences between the fees they are responsible (such as court filing fees or photocopies), and the attorney fees which are determined by the complexity of your case.
